Eligibility
The Maine Morgan Breeder's Class which will be hosted by the Maine Morgan Horse Show on Friday evening. The weanling class is open to all Morgan weanlings registered or eligible for registration. The yearling class is open to all registered Morgan yearlings. Both classes will be judged according to the current Morgan Breed Rules for the Morgan In Hand class, found in the current USA Equestrian Rule Book. These classes are to be judged by the Main Ring Horse Show Judge(s) who will judge independently, but concurrently. Proper evening attire is encouraged.

Judging
Entries will be called into the ring to be exhibited individually before the judge(s). The order will be drawn by lot and will be posted in the secretary's office no later than 1:00 p.m. of the day of the class. There will be a one and one half minute time limit for each individual presentation. Each entry must be presented before the judge(s) at a walk, standing and at a trot on the line and must at some point be judged standing squarely on all four feet. Each judge will score each entry a maximum of 100 points in Round 1.

After all entries have been judged individually, the scores from the judge(s) will be combined. The top ten entries will be announced in no particular order and called back into the ring to be judged as a group for final determination. Horses will be shown stretched, however, either judge may ask any entry to repeat any part of the presentation from Round 1. Each judge will score each entry a maximum of 100 points in Round 2. When the judge(s) have completed judging Round 2, the scores from Round 1 and Round 2 will be combined to determine final placing. In case of a tie, the higher score from Round 2 will be the deciding factor. In Round 2 scores are equal then the ties will be broken by entries showing in front of the judges at the pleasure of the judges.

Awards
The award of the top ten places will be announced in reverse order from 10th place up through Reserve Champion, and finally Champion. Cash awards for these classes are as follows:   
 

First  $1,500
Second 750
Third 400
Fourth 250
Fifth 100
Sixth 100
Seventh 100
Eighth 100
Nineth 100
Tenth 100

Checks will be sent to the recipients at the mailing addresses provided on the entry form within two weeks following the show.
